The New Quad Building King Julian Smith Has The Most Insane Leg Training

by GI Team Published on Jan 1, 2019

This post may contain affiliate links (disclosure policy).

For Julian Smith leg training requires more than just squats.

You can find many bodybuilders working hard to attain massive wheels on leg day. For the most part you can find these athletes at the squat rack as they look to add mass to their frames, particularly their quads. But unlike many of the other bodybuilders out there, Julian Smith is taking a very different approach to his leg development training.

Rather than just focus on classical squats, Julian Smith employs movements that you don’t see very often in modern day bodybuilding. In reality, that’s by design. Smith is an advocate for old school bodybuilding training and as such utilizes a vast of array of exercises during his training.

While most other bodybuilders are finding themselves at that squat rack on leg day, you can find Julian Smith performing extreme movements like these in order to shape and build his legs.

Link in bio – Body weight sissy squat- Body weight moves I usually take to failure. As many as I can do with proper perfect form. Slow negatives with a pauses on the stretch. – Perfect form on sissy squats is actually pretty simple. Upper leg and torso should be in a straight line. This is gonna put maximum stretch and tension in the quads ? When your upper body and upper leg are straight you can feel the stretch from low by your knees, all up to your hips! – Give this exercise a shot! Tag me in your story if you do.
